Older septic tanks can cause problems when they discharge directly to a watercourse or struggle to cope with modern household use. You may notice slow-draining sinks, damp patches near the tank, sewage odours, lush grass around the drainage field, or standing water after heavy rain. These signs do not always mean the whole system has failed, but they should be checked before the issue spreads.

Practical installation advice from survey to sign-off
Every site has different constraints. Access, soil type, groundwater level, nearby ditches, trees, boundaries and the distance from buildings all affect the design. Proseptic can assess the existing drainage layout and recommend whether a sewage treatment plant is the right option, or whether remedial work may be enough.
Our installation service can include:
- Site inspection and drainage assessment
- Advice on plant size and discharge options
- Excavation and installation work
- Pipework connections and system commissioning
- Guidance on maintenance and ongoing compliance
Where the existing system needs further investigation, a CCTV drain survey can help locate damaged pipework, root ingress, collapsed sections or misconnections before installation work starts. If the issue relates to an old tank, our septic tank replacement service may also be relevant.
